Transaction 2f115497c3e336babde5a787d38ea1fed078acff396719776e9aa101f3f483b4

32 Input
2 Outputs
  • 2f115497c3e336babde5a787d38ea1fed078acff396719776e9aa101f3f483b4:0
  • value  774991
    address  39YHVJgTv6xGMFdk5z4mKEcxJjA6GTWSAk
  • 2f115497c3e336babde5a787d38ea1fed078acff396719776e9aa101f3f483b4:1
  • value  628738881
    address  3KKYusWjETX3L5xGign7WByz1UDsXpytZK